Lavida Hatchback shows door open light and doors cannot be locked?
1 Answers
Lavida Hatchback shows door open light and doors cannot be locked due to the following reasons: Failure of the vehicle's central locking system: Check whether the installation of components and connecting wires is intact, and then check whether the connection of power wires and ground wires to the battery is normal. Indicates a problem with the electronic control switch box: The locking switch is damaged or there is a circuit failure, and each part needs to be inspected. Failure of the mechanical transmission device: The door lock motor of one door or two doors is damaged or the wires are broken. Then it may be that the mechanical transmission device is faulty, causing the doors to fail to lock.
